Chutney Chicken


Very flavorful dish full of aroma, specially when you are sick of eating same chicken curry everyday. My very own recipe, just love it with vinegar pickled green peppers ā¤

Ingredients:

  • 1.5 kg chicken, cut into 12 – 16 pcs.
  • 2 medium sized onions, sliced
  • 1 tbspn freshly crushed ginger and garlic
  • 1 cup oil

FOR CHUTNEY

  • 1 bunch or 1 cup coriander leaves
  • 2 garlic cloves
  • 2 tomatoes, sliced
  • 2 tbspns lemon juice
  • 3 green chillies
  • 1 cup yogurt
  • Salt
  • 1 tspn red chilli powder
  • 1 tspn turmeric
  • 1 tspn coriander powder
  • 1 tspn cumin seeds

FOR GARNISHING

  • Few coriander leaves
  • Few ginger juliennes
  • Few lemon wedges or slices

Method

  • Wash and pat dry chicken pieces and put them in a deep mixing bowl.
  • Combine all the ingredients (except yogurt) given for chutney in blender and make chutney. It is more like tomato chutney.
  • Pour over the chutney on to chicken pieces and marinade for 1 hour. Now mix in whipped yogurt (without water) and leave for 30 more minutes.
  • Meanwhile, heat oil and fry onion. Add ginger garlic when onions are translucent so they are fried with onion.
  • Add marinated chicken pieces leaving the marinade in the bowl and stir fry for 10 minutes. Now add the remaining mixture in the bowl and cook it covered on low medium heat for 20 minutes.
  • The oil will begin to separate, add garnish ingredients and serve hot with roti.
